热处理煤矸石活性评价方法的研究

摘    要:用X射线光电子能谱(XPS对热处理煤矸石中Si 2p,Al 2p和O 1s的结合能进行试验研究,发现煤矸石质硅铝基胶凝材料的强度和煤矸石中硅、铝的结合能具有线性关系,煤矸石的硅、铝结合能可以用来表征煤矸石的胶凝特性和活性.热活化煤矸石Si 2p,Al 2p和O 1s的结合能之间具有很好的相关性.基于此提出硅铝质物料活性评价的新方法--用Si,Al表面结合能评价硅铝质物料活性.

关 键 词:煤矸石  活性评价  热活化  表面结合能  X射线光电子能谱(XPS)

Study on activity evaluation of thermal treated gangue

Abstract:The binding energies of Si 2p,Al 2p and O 1s electrons of thermal treated gangue samples were measured by using X-ray photoelectron spectroscopy(XPS).It is found that the linear relationship is between the binding energies of Si 2p and Al 2p of gangue and compressive strength of gangue-containing aluminosilicate based cementitious materials.Binding energies of Si 2p and Al 2p of gangue indicate cementitious properties and activity of gangue.Binding energies of Si 2p,Al 2p and O 1s of the thermal treated gangue have good correlation.The binding energies of Si 2p and Al 2p is an effective and new method to evaluate the activity of Si-Al material.
Keywords:gangue  activity evaluation  thermal treatment  binding energy  X-ray photoelectron spectroscopy(XPS)
